A scene of absolute chaos unfolded in Deoria, Uttar Pradesh, when a teenage girl climbed to the topmost part of a mobile communication tower. The girl declared to the gathered crowd and police that she wished to marry her boyfriend and refused to descend until her demands were addressed.

Upon receiving the alert, Lar Station House Officer Rakesh Singh and his team rushed to the spot. The rescue operation faced immediate hurdles as the girl had covered her face, making identification impossible. To overcome this, the police deployed a drone camera to get a clear view of her position and identity.

As the standoff continued, the police arranged for loudspeakers and microphones to communicate with the girl from a distance. For nearly two and a half hours, officials pleaded with her, assuring her that her grievances would be heard and legal recourse would be explored regarding her relationship.

Eventually, trusting the police's assurance, the girl descended safely. After being rescued, she revealed that she was in love with a youth from the Mail police station area. She further disclosed that her family had filed a formal complaint against the youth on August 30, which had triggered her extreme reaction.

CO Gaurav Singh confirmed that the girl was safely rescued with the help of locals and that the police are currently investigating the matter. Videos of the incident have since gone viral on social media, sparking debates on juvenile mental health and familial pressure.
